    College Revokes Degree of Grad Who Lied on His Application

    Jan 04, 2019

    A university in Hubei province canceled a graduate’s degree after learning that he had falsified part of his application, The Paper reported Thursday.

    In late December, Wuhan University posted a memo online saying that the diploma of 2017 graduate Zhu Yi had been revoked after Hubei’s sports administration notified the school of an inconsistency on his application. Zhu had claimed to hold the prestigious title of national-level athlete; however, the administration later realized that because Zhu had not shown up to play in the national badminton championship in May 2012, he was ineligible for the accolade.

    Zhu had used his ill-gotten athletic fame to gain admission to Wuhan University as a high-level athlete, which allowed him to score lower on his entrance exams. He enrolled in the school’s media and communications department in 2013 and graduated with an advertising degree in 2017. (Image: VCG)
